Full Job Description
Job Description

We're looking for a Windows Systems Administrator to provide advanced technical computer, infrastructure, and operations support for enterprise Windows systems and related services. You will work in a safety-conscious, challenging, rapidly changing, and team-oriented environment to solve complex technical problems in a timely manner. This position is in the Information Technology Operations, ITO, Division within the Computing Directorate.

This position requires full-time on-site presence due to the nature of the work.

This position will be filled at either level based on knowledge and related experience as assessed by the hiring team. Additional job responsibilities (outlined below) will be assigned if hired at the higher level.

You will
  • Perform advanced troubleshooting and administration for Windows Server, Active Directory, DNS, Group Policy, authentication, and related system integrations.
  • Install, configure, maintain, patch, harden, and secure Windows servers and supporting infrastructure services.
  • Administer enterprise backup systems, including job monitoring, failure remediation, restore operations, retention management, and recovery validation.
  • Analyze complex incidents, identify root causes, implement corrective actions, and document resolutions.
  • Develop and maintain PowerShell scripts and utilities to automate administration, monitoring, reporting, and support processes.
  • Support cybersecurity operations, including account management, access controls, vulnerability remediation, system monitoring, compliance activities, and preparation of technical artifacts for Assessment and Authorization and ATO activities.
  • Provide technical guidance and escalation support to Tier 1 and Tier 2 staff, and maintain accurate SOPs, knowledge articles, and system documentation.
  • Participate in infrastructure upgrades, migrations, disaster-recovery and business-continuity exercises, datacenter operations, and operational improvement projects across Corporate and Isolated Networks.
  • Perform other duties as assigned.

Additional job responsibilities, at the 393.2 level
  • Diagnose, troubleshoot, and resolve highly complex Windows, system, network, backup, and integration problems, including driving problem resolution, working with vendors, and managing support cases as required.
  • Serve as a technical leader and internal and external consultant, providing highly advanced technical assistance to the user community and collaborating with customers in the design and implementation of computing environments.
  • Provide technical leadership for complex upgrades, migrations, disaster-recovery activities, cybersecurity remediation, and operational improvement projects.
  • Mentor Tier 1 and Tier 2 staff and provide guidance on troubleshooting methods, system administration practices, and technical procedures.
  • Lead root-cause investigations and develop corrective actions for recurring or highly complex incidents.
  • Support the development, review, and maintenance of technical artifacts and evidence for ATO packages and other compliance activities.

Pay Range

$125,310 - $153,444 Yearly at the 393.1 level

$151,620 - $185,640 Yearly at the 393.2 level

This is the lowest to highest salary we in good faith believe we would pay for this role at the time of this posting; pay will not be below any applicable local minimum wage. An employee's position within the salary range will be based on several factors including, but not limited to, specific competencies, relevant education, qualifications, certifications, experience, skills, seniority, geographic location, performance, and business or organizational needs.
